如何优化OpenAI模型的性能

本文详细讨论了优化OpenAI模型性能的方法,关键点包括:数据预处理、模型优化、硬件选择高效编程技巧。数据预处理强调对输入数据的清洗和转换,以最大化模型的学习效率。模型优化探讨如何通过调整模型架构并应用迁移学习来提升性能。硬件选择分析了适合OpenAI模型的计算资源,并强调了为模型选择合适的硬件环境的重要性。最后,高效编程技巧提供了确保代码效率和模型性能的建议。

如何优化OpenAI模型的性能

一、数据预处理

数据预处理是提升OpenAI模型性能的关键步骤。它涉及了数据的清洗、转换正规化。在清洗过程中,去除错误和不一致的数据是首要工作。这可以通过自动化脚本或手动检查完成。数据转换则包括将文本、图像或音频数据转换成模型可以处理的格式。正规化过程确保所有的输入数据都遵循同一标准,比如,将所有文本输入转化为小写或者统一图像的分辨率。

二、模型优化

模型优化可以通过多种方式实现,包括超参数调整架构更迭以及迁移学习。超参数调整涉及对学习率、批量大小或其他模型参数的反复试验。架构更迭意味着在保持模型效能的同时减少复杂性,例如,通过剪枝技术去除不重要的网络部分。迁移学习则是使用在其他任务上训练好的模型来加速当前任务模型的学习,它可以显著减少数据需求和训练时间。

三、硬件选择

在硬件选择方面,GPU加速TPU的应用或者分布式计算是优化OpenAI模型重要考虑的方面。GPUs是训练复杂深度学习模型的首选硬件,因为它们能够并行处理大量计算。TPUs则提供了更快的矩阵乘法能力,适合于大规模的模型训练。分布式计算允许模型在多台机器上并行训练,这样可以处理更大的数据集合并缩短训练时间。

四、高效编程技巧

高效的编程技巧包括确保代码的优化模块化,这可以提升模型训练和推理的速度。代码优化可以通过利用库函数代替自编函数来实现,因为库函数通常经过高度优化。模块化编程则有利于代码的复用与维护,同时也方便进行单独模块的测试和优化。利用高级的编程语言特性,如异步编程和多线程,也可以加速数据加载和预处理过程。

文章版权归“万象方舟”www.vientianeark.cn所有。发布者:小飞棍来咯,转载请注明出处:https://www.vientianeark.cn/p/5335/

(0)
上一篇 2023年11月19日 下午10:38
下一篇 2023年11月19日 下午10:41

相关推荐

  • OpenAI的最新研究成果有哪些

    至今,OpenAI公司推出了一系列引人注目的研究成果。1、自然语言处理模型GPT-3:随着深度学习的快速发展,GPT-3成为了目前最先进的语言模型之一,适用于各种语言任务。2、多模态AI DALL·E:这个模型能够通过文本描述生成独特的图片,表明了AI在理解和创造视觉内容方面的进步。3、机器人技术和自动化:OpenAI利用机器学习训练机器人执行多种任务,这些研究为未来工业自动化和服务业打下基础。4…

    2023年11月20日
    12200
  • ChatGPT4.0在教育领域的应用与其他模型比较

    随着人工智能的进步,ChatGPT4.0在教育领域的应用展现出显著优势。与前代模型比较,1、ChatGPT4.0拥有更丰富的知识库、2、更精细的语言理解和生成能力、3、更高的互动性与适应性。尤其是在提升互动性方面,ChatGPT4.0在应对学生的提问和反馈时表现出更高的效率和准确性。 ChatGPT4.0的互动性与适应性主要表现在对话的自然流畅度方面。它能够依据上下文提供更贴合学生需求的回答,进而…

    2023年12月19日
    13800
  • 如何在ChatGPT4.0中切换话题

    在ChatGPT4.0中切换话题时,用户可通过1、直接提出新话题、2、运用转折词语引入新话题、3、采用问答形式逐步过渡、4、利用相关性链接进行平滑过渡。特别是使用转折词语,它能够缓和话题的转变,让交流显得更为自然。例如,引入诸如“顺便问一下”、“另外”、“对了”这样的词汇,能够有效过渡到另一主题。 一、直接引入新话题 在ChatGPT4.0对话中切换话题时,表达要明确、简洁以及相关。新话题的引入无…

    2023年12月19日
    11800
  • 怎么登录chatgpt

    登录ChatGPT流程涉及几个关键步骤1、访问服务提供网站2、注册帐户3、邮箱验证4、登录操作。注册帐户时,用户需填写必要信息,如电子邮件、创建密码,之后通过邮件链接激活帐户。此动作目的在于确认注册者身份,预防未经授权的访问。 一、探索服务官方网站 开通ChatGPT之旅,第一步需要确定GPT平台的官方网址。用户浏览器中输入正确网站地址即可打开服务主页。 二、创建个人帐户 帐户建立需求用户提供一些…

    2024年3月26日
    8000
  • chatgpt怎么expand

    CHATGPT 扩展性考量涵盖以下几个方面:1、算法更新 2、数据集增强 3、模型架构调整 4、计算资源增加。对于算法更新,开发团队需定期评估算法的效果与准确度,继而进行适当修改以适应新的需求和挑战。 在详细阐述中,可具体深入探讨如何通过不断学习与自我优化来不断提升CHATGPT的性能。例如,算法的更新不仅需要了解当前技术的最新进展,还需要预测未来潜在的需求变化,确保CHATGPT在不断演变的AI…

    2024年3月30日
    8700

发表回复

登录后才能评论
站长微信
站长微信
分享本页
返回顶部